    Assignee: Daiwa Seiko, Inc.
    Inventors: Harumichi Oishi, Mikiharu Kobayashi, Masashi Ono
  • Patent number: 7198219
    Abstract: Fishing reel control apparatus, comprising a pulley carried for rotation in opposite directions; a ratchet wheel carried for rotation; a spring wire wrapped about a portion of the pulley and having a projecting end; a pivoted dog connected to the wire end so that endwise displacement of the wire effected by pulley rotation operates to release the dog from the ratchet wheel when the pulley is rotated in one direction, whereby a fishing line spool attached to the ratchet wheel is free to rotate, as the line pays out from the spool; and whereby when the pulley is rotated in opposite direction the wire is displaced to pivot the dog into engagement with the ratchet wheel, and the spool is rotated by the ratchet wheel to wrap the line as the pulley is rotated relative to the wire.

    Abstract: A fishing reel drag mechanism includes a spool for a fishing line, a brake drum attached coaxially to the spool, and a resilient circular brake shoe positioned inside the brake drum. The outer diameter of the brake shoe is slightly smaller than the inner diameter of the brake drum. A gap is provided on the brake shoe, and a movable spreader is positioned in the gap. When the spreader is moved to a first position, the brake shoe is in a relaxed position spaced from the brake drum, so that the spool may rotate with zero drag. When the spreader is gradually moved to a second position, the gap is gradually expanded by the spreader, and the brake shoe is gradually expanded against the brake drum. The drag on the brake drum is thus adjusted by changing the width of the gap with the spreader. Grooves arranged concentrically around the brake shoe provide additional compliance which improves smoothness in drag application and the range of drag force provided.
